    I come from Indianapolis and Bloomington, IN, and I'm here to represent. Several of the bands I've submitted hail from there or have some sort of Indiana connection. Secretly Canadian and Smokey Lung are my favorite labels from Bloomington, to name a couple. I'll also be submitting quite a few San Francisco bay area bands since that's where I now live.
